Mark Paich , Ph.D.
Principal, Decisio Consulting


Mark has over 25 years of experience in building dynamic business models. Mark has a BA in political economy from Colorado College, an MA in economics from the University of Colorado, and a Ph.D. in system dynamics from MIT. Mark’s specialty is the dynamics of new industry creation and he has worked extensively in telematics (GM Onstar system), Digital radio (XM and WorldSpace), fuel cell and hybrid vehicles (GM), and various pharmaceutical products. Selected clients include General Motors, Eli Lilly, Johnson & Johnson, and the Department of Defense Mark was senior specialist at McKinsey & Co. from 1998-2001. A number of Mark’s consulting projects are described in John Sterman’s book Business Dynamics.

Mark taught economics, finance, and business strategy at Colorado College for 25 years and is a frequent guest lecturer at MIT’s Sloan School of Management. In 2000, Mark and his co-authors from GM placed second in the 2001 Edelman competition for the best work in operations research and management science.
